Cum să mascați datele în Oracle
Publicat: 2022-03-30Oracle Database este una dintre cele mai utilizate baze de date din lume. Este, de asemenea, o componentă importantă a suitei de produse Oracle, inclusiv produsul Fusion Middleware.
Dacă doriți să ascundeți datele sensibile de la utilizatori atunci când utilizați Oracle, acest articol vă va ajuta să realizați exact asta.
Introducere: Când vine vorba de informații sensibile, știm cu toții că nu are rost să ascundem datele. În schimb, ceea ce dorim să facem este să „mascăm” datele astfel încât să nu poată fi văzute de nimeni, cu excepția persoanei căreia i s-a acordat acces la date. De exemplu, un utilizator poate să fi primit acces la un tabel Oracle care conține informații despre conturile sale bancare. Informațiile contului sunt însă mascate, astfel încât doar utilizatorul să le poată vedea.
În acest articol, vom vorbi despre mascarea datelor în Oracle, inclusiv:
1. Ce este Mascarea datelor în Oracle?
Mascarea datelor este una dintre cele mai bune moduri de a face ca baza de date Oracle să pară mai demnă de încredere și mai sigură. Termenul a fost inventat inițial de guvernul SUA în anii 1990 și se referă la procesul de ascundere a datelor de la o anumită persoană sau organizație. De exemplu, dacă o corporație mare dorea să ascundă date despre activități ilegale, corporația ar putea să preia datele și să le plaseze într-o bază de date sau un tabel mai mic la care doar câțiva angajați ai companiei au acces. Ideea este să ne asigurăm că datele nu ajung niciodată în ochii publicului.
Oracle Database are capacitatea de a vă masca datele sensibile în timpul stocării sau în timpul procesării de către un program. Puteți utiliza funcția pentru a crea un mediu de stocare sigur și eficient pentru datele sensibile. Datele mascate sunt încă utilizabile, dar sunt ascunse de utilizatori, aplicații și alte programe. Apoi puteți accesa datele mascate folosind instrucțiunea UNMASK.
Înseamnă ascunderea sau ascunderea datelor, astfel încât să nu poată fi citite sau modificate de utilizatori neautorizați. Mascarea datelor poate fi utilizată pentru a ascunde numerele cardurilor de credit și numerele de securitate socială. Mascarea datelor este o caracteristică de securitate și nu are scopul de a împiedica vizualizarea datelor de către un utilizator autorizat.
Citește și: Sfaturi privind securitatea cibernetică și protecția datelor cu caracter personal pentru a fi în siguranță
2. Creați un plan de mascare a datelor
Când vine vorba de colectarea de date online, consumatorii devin din ce în ce mai conștienți de cât de valoroase sunt informațiile lor personale pentru agenții de marketing. Și din această cauză, mascarea datelor devine o strategie de marketing foarte populară pentru a combate această problemă. Aceasta implică crearea unei baze de date separate pentru publicul dvs. și utilizarea acestor informații pentru a le trimite mesaje fără a putea asocia marca dvs. cu acel consumator anume. Ideea este că îi veți contacta cu mesaje utile și direcționate despre produsul sau serviciul dvs., toate rămânând anonim.
Deși mascarea datelor este importantă în orice cercetare, este puțin mai complicată atunci când faci un studiu despre o situație reală, cum ar fi o experiență de afaceri sau educațională. Dacă sondajul dvs. va fi completat de o grămadă de oameni, nu doriți să le oferiți toate informațiile despre cum să vă răspundeți la întrebări, așa că trebuie să vă asigurați că ascundeți punctele sensibile ale datelor. Acest lucru este dificil mai ales când vine vorba de întrebări precum rasă, sex, etnie, sexualitate etc., deoarece dacă sunt introduse date greșite, s-ar putea ajunge la rezultate distorsionate.
3. Implementați planul de mascare a datelor
Este vital pentru companii să se asigure că au planul corect de mascare a datelor. Fără un plan de mascare, riscați să pierdeți clienți și să suportați amenzi conform GDPR (Regulamentul general privind protecția datelor). Cu toate acestea, cu un plan bun de mascare a datelor, vă puteți menține conform companiei și puteți permite datelor să rămână private. Pentru mai multe informații despre conformitatea cu GDPR și despre cum să vă mențineți afacerea în linie, am compilat câteva resurse utile mai jos:
Trebuie să decideți cum să tratați datele pe care le colectați despre clienții dvs. După cum am spus mai sus, această decizie va afecta modul în care puteți utiliza datele în viitor. Una dintre cele mai bune modalități de a vă păstra colecția de date curată și fără pată este să „mascați” datele colectate. Aceasta este o modalitate excelentă de a vă asigura că nu expuneți date sensibile potențialilor atacatori. Mascarea datelor este, de asemenea, o strategie excelentă dacă intenționați să publicați rapoarte despre datele pe care le-ați colectat. Pentru a vă asigura că rapoartele dvs. nu sunt compromise, veți dori să eliminați orice informație sensibilă din raport înainte de a le distribui.
Citește și: Amenințări de securitate cibernetică la adresa întreprinderilor mici
4. Care sunt diferitele tipuri de baze de date Oracle?
Oracle Database este un sistem de management al bazelor de date relaționale (RDBMS) care permite stocarea datelor structurate într-un mediu multi-utilizator, multiplatformă. Oracle Database este una dintre cele mai populare baze de date open-source dintr-un motiv anume. Cu peste 25 de ani de experiență în dezvoltarea de soluții de înaltă performanță pentru întreprinderi, Oracle oferă o familie completă de soluții software care le permite companiilor să își gestioneze eficient informațiile, să obțină informații în timp real și să conducă transformarea afacerii. Oracle Database este disponibil în modele on-premise, bazate pe cloud și hibride.
Există trei soiuri majore de baze de date Oracle: Oracle Database, Oracle Database 11g și Oracle Database 12c. Ultima dintre acestea este cea mai nouă varietate a bazei de date.
5. Cum să mascați datele Oracle?
Când vorbim despre mascarea datelor Oracle, ne referim la o strategie de mascare a datelor care este utilizată pentru a proteja datele și informațiile sensibile dintr-un sistem de întreprindere. Oracle Data Masking este procesul de înlocuire a datelor sensibile cu o valoare sau date mai inofensive pentru a masca datele de la vizualizare sau acces.
Ca sursă numărul unu de date, Oracle este o parte foarte importantă a oricărui CRM. Pentru a le masca datele, puteți utiliza o combinație de diferite caracteristici, inclusiv Oracle Cloud Service, care este disponibil pe site-ul web Oracle și vă permite să vă accesați datele de oriunde, chiar dacă sunt pe telefonul mobil; și Oracle Database, pe care o puteți folosi pentru a vă cripta datele și a le stoca în siguranță.
- Hack: Utilizați un tabel temporar de bază de date pentru a vă masca datele.
- Hack: creați un tabel temporar pentru fiecare interogare de utilizator și introduceți rezultatele în tabelul principal.
- Hack: Când trebuie să mascați un tabel, utilizați o declarație #define pentru a realiza acest lucru.
- Hack: mențineți două baze de date și utilizați un instrument precum DBUtils pentru a vă masca datele.
- Hack: utilizați metoda Oracle SEQUEL table pentru a masca tabelele din aplicația dvs.
- Hack: Dacă aveți opțiunea, utilizați suportul BLOB încorporat al Oracle 12c.
Citește și: Ce este VPN și cum funcționează?
În concluzie, pentru o mai bună înțelegere a bazei de date Oracle, ar trebui să înțelegeți mai întâi structura acesteia. În acest tutorial, vom folosi structura tabelelor unei baze de date Oracle pentru a vedea cum să mascam datele. Vom vedea cum să folosim caracteristicile de mascare a datelor din Oracle Database și cum ne ajută să mascam datele. Conceptul de mascare a datelor este destul de simplu. După ce ați citit acest articol, ar trebui să puteți înțelege cum să mascați datele într-o bază de date Oracle.